Enhance Your Defenses: Five Essential Types with Access Control
In today's digital landscape, safeguarding your valuable/sensitive/critical data is paramount. Access control plays a crucial role/part/function in preventing/mitigating/stopping unauthorized access and potential threats. Implementing robust access control measures can significantly strengthen/fortify/enhance your defenses. Here are five essential types of access control to consider:
- Rigid Access Control: This type implements predefined/specific/clear rules and policies governing user access to resources. It enforces a strict hierarchy/structure/framework of permissions, ensuring that users can only access/view/utilize authorized data and applications.
- Discretionary Access Control: This approach grants users the ability/power/freedom to control access to their own resources. Owners can delegate/assign/grant permissions to others based on their needs and trust levels, allowing for greater flexibility/customization/adaptability.
- Role-Based Access Control: This method assigns users to specific roles, each with predefined access rights. By aligning user permissions with their job functions, this approach simplifies administration and reduces/minimizes/eliminates the risk of overexposure.
- Rule-Based Access Control: This type utilizes a set of pre-defined rules to determine access. These rules can be based on various factors, such as user identity, location, time of day, or specific actions. The system enforces/implements/executes these rules to grant or deny access accordingly.
- Attribute-Based Access Control: This advanced approach leverages attributes about users, resources, and the context of access requests. It allows for more granular/refined/precise control by defining permissions based on a combination of factors, such as user skills, device type, or environmental conditions.
